Western New England English exhibits the entire continuum of possibilities regarding the cotcaught merger: a full merger is heard in its northern reaches (namely, Vermont) and a full distinction at its southern reaches (namely, coastal Connecticut), and a transitional area in the middle. The following terms originate from and are used commonly and nearly exclusively throughout New England: As in the rest of the Northeast, sneakers is the primary term for athletic shoes, tractor trailer for semi-trailer truck, cellar for basement, brook is common for stream, and soda is any sweet and bubbly non-alcoholic drink. New England English is, collectively, the various distinct dialects and varieties of American English originating in the New England area.
